在企业中,APS(高级计划与排程系统) 与其他管理软件(如 ERP(企业资源规划)、 MES(制造执行系统)、 SCM(供应链管理) 等)协同工作的顺畅与否,直接影响到整体业务流程的效率。如果系统集成困难,可能会导致数据不一致、信息流转不畅、响应延迟等问题,进而影响生产调度、资源配置和决策制定。以下是常见的系统集成难点及其解决方案:
1. 数据格式和标准不一致
不同系统可能使用不同的数据格式、数据库架构和数据标准,这会导致系统间的兼容性问题,进而影响数据的顺畅流转。例如,APS 可能使用某种特定格式的计划数据,而 ERP 系统则使用不同的物料管理标准。数据不兼容会导致信息传递错误或滞后,进而影响决策效率和生产计划的执行。
解决方案:
- 数据标准化与映射:建立统一的数据标准,并通过数据映射和转换接口确保各系统之间的数据一致性。
- 中间件集成:利用中间件(如 ESB(企业服务总线))或 API(应用程序接口) 对不同系统进行数据转换和适配,确保各系统能够无缝对接。
2. 缺乏实时数据同步
APS系统依赖于实时数据(如库存、生产进度、设备状态等)来做出准确的排产决策。如果其他管理系统(如ERP或MES)中的数据没有及时同步到APS,可能会导致APS的排产计划与实际生产情况不符,从而影响生产计划的执行和调整。
解决方案:
- 实时数据集成:确保APS与ERP、MES等系统之间的数据能够实时同步,采用 实时数据流 技术或 事件驱动架构 来确保数据的一致性。
- 数据接口与API优化:使用标准化API接口,确保实时传输库存、订单、生产状态等关键信息,减少信息传递的延迟。
3. 系统间的功能重叠与不匹配
不同管理软件的功能往往有交集,导致系统间的重复功能和操作冗余。例如,APS和ERP都可能有库存管理的功能,但它们的管理思路和数据处理方式不同,导致功能重叠而无法高效协作。此外,有些系统的功能设计和数据流程可能不符合APS的需求,导致系统之间不能顺畅交互。
解决方案:
- 明确系统职能与责任:明确每个系统的职责范围,避免功能重叠。可以通过系统模块化的设计,让各系统专注于自己的核心业务,避免交叉功能和冗余操作。
- 建立系统间的接口协议:在实施过程中,设计清晰的接口协议和功能划分,确保APS与其他系统通过标准的接口进行数据交换和操作交互。
4. 不同系统的业务流程不一致
不同系统通常反映了不同的业务流程(如生产、库存管理、采购等),而这些流程在某些环节上可能不一致。比如,APS 可能基于最优化的生产排程来制定计划,而 ERP 系统则侧重于基于订单处理来管理物料库存,这可能会导致计划和实际操作之间的矛盾。
解决方案:
- 统一业务流程建模:在系统集成前,进行跨部门的业务流程分析,统一流程标准,确保不同系统的业务流程能够兼容。可以通过 BPM(业务流程管理) 来优化和集成不同系统的业务流程。
- 流程调度系统设计:建立统一的流程调度平台,协调各系统间的工作流,确保数据从一个系统流入另一个系统时能够自动触发相关业务流程。
5. 系统整合成本与复杂度高
APS与其他管理软件(如ERP、MES等)的整合需要进行大量的开发和定制,尤其是在多系统、多部门的情况下,可能会导致项目实施周期长、成本高、技术难度大。
解决方案:
- 逐步集成与模块化设计:避免一次性大规模整合,可以采用 分阶段实施 的方式,逐步实现系统间的集成,减少初期的技术复杂度和成本。
- 云平台集成:采用基于云的解决方案,可以通过云平台进行多系统集成,简化本地化的IT架构,提高灵活性和可扩展性。
- 第三方集成工具和平台:使用成熟的第三方集成工具(如 MuleSoft、Dell Boomi、SAP PI 等)来降低系统集成的复杂度,减少定制开发的需求。
6. 不同系统的用户界面与体验差异
APS和其他系统的用户界面可能存在差异,使得操作人员在使用不同系统时面临不一致的用户体验,这可能导致操作错误、效率低下和系统之间的协调问题。
解决方案:
- 统一用户界面设计:在系统集成时,尽可能采用统一的用户界面设计标准,减少用户在不同系统间切换时的学习成本。
- 集成操作平台:开发一个统一的操作平台或门户,通过集中管理的方式让用户能够在一个界面上同时操作不同系统,从而提升用户的操作效率和系统之间的协作。
7. 缺乏跨系统的协同工作机制
不同系统之间的协同工作缺乏良好的机制或沟通渠道,可能导致信息和任务流转不畅。尤其是在多部门、多系统的环境中,缺乏协同机制容易导致信息孤岛,影响业务流程的流畅性。
解决方案:
- 跨系统工作流管理:建立跨系统的工作流管理机制,确保在不同系统之间的任务和数据流动顺畅。可以通过工作流自动化工具(如 BPMS(业务流程管理系统))来提高系统间的协同效率。
- 跨部门协作与培训:加强部门之间的沟通与协作,确保各部门在系统操作和数据流转中的协调,定期进行跨系统操作的培训,提高员工的跨系统操作能力。
总结
系统集成困难可能会严重影响APS与其他管理软件的协同效率,进而影响生产计划和排程的准确性。通过数据标准化、实时数据同步、功能明确、逐步实施等手段,可以有效解决系统集成问题,提高各系统之间的协同效果,确保生产计划的顺利执行和资源的优化配置。